Mercurial > dive4elements > river
diff flys-client/src/main/java/de/intevation/flys/client/client/ui/WQSimpleArrayPanel.java @ 1576:8e5c5c70c586
Implemented WQSimpleArrayPanel.createOld().
flys-client/trunk@3842 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Ingo Weinzierl <ingo.weinzierl@intevation.de> |
---|---|
date | Tue, 31 Jan 2012 15:22:48 +0000 |
parents | 3324ef9d8341 |
children | e53d773e6992 |
line wrap: on
line diff
--- a/flys-client/src/main/java/de/intevation/flys/client/client/ui/WQSimpleArrayPanel.java Tue Jan 31 15:20:17 2012 +0000 +++ b/flys-client/src/main/java/de/intevation/flys/client/client/ui/WQSimpleArrayPanel.java Tue Jan 31 15:22:48 2012 +0000 @@ -70,8 +70,11 @@ @Override public Canvas createOld(DataList dataList) { - Data data = dataList.get(0); - DataItem[] items = data.getItems(); + IntegerOptionsData modeData = findOptionsData(dataList); + IntegerArrayData valuesData = findValuesData(dataList); + + DataItem[] modeItems = modeData.getItems(); + DataItem[] valuesItems = valuesData.getItems(); HLayout layout = new HLayout(); VLayout valueContainer = new VLayout(); @@ -80,12 +83,11 @@ label.setWidth(200); label.setHeight(20); - // TODO Display mode and selected values - Label mode = new Label("TODO: IMPLEMENT MODE"); + Label mode = new Label(modeItems[0].getLabel()); mode.setHeight(20); mode.setWidth(150); - Label values = new Label("TODO: IMPLEMENT VALUES"); + Label values = new Label(valuesItems[0].getLabel()); values.setHeight(20); values.setWidth(150);